Half of the Warriors' possessions were awful. They were just running down and letting Curry or Thompson chunk up difficult shots.
The offensive rebounding is what killed the Pels. You're up by 15, with a limited amount of time left. In that situation, you have to limit your opponents' chances.
In overtime, once the Warriors had settled down, it was too late for Asik at that point IMO. But I guess since Bogut was in for GS, Monty wanted Asik in too.
